Randomized Controlled Trial Comparative StudyReal-time ultrasound-guided subclavian vein cannulation versus the landmark method in critical care patients: a prospective randomized study.
Subclavian vein catheterization may cause various complications. We compared the real-time ultrasound-guided subclavian vein cannulation vs. the landmark method in critical care patients. ⋯ The present data suggested that ultrasound-guided cannulation of the subclavian vein in critical care patients is superior to the landmark method and should be the method of choice in these patients.

Randomized Controlled Trial Comparative StudyThe effect of two different electronic health record user interfaces on intensive care provider task load, errors of cognition, and performance.
The care of critically ill patients generates large quantities of data. Increasingly, these data are presented to the provider within an electronic medical record. The manner in which data are organized and presented can impact on the ability of users to synthesis that data into meaningful information. The objective of this study was to test the hypothesis that novel user interfaces, which prioritize the display of high-value data to providers within system-based packages, reduce task load, and result in fewer errors of cognition compared with established user interfaces that do not. ⋯ A novel user interface was designed based on the information needs of intensive care unit providers with a specific goal of development being the reduction of task load and errors of cognition associated with filtering, extracting, and using medical data contained within a comprehensive electronic medical record. The results of this simulated clinical experiment suggest that the configuration of the intensive care unit user interface contributes significantly to the task load, time to task completion, and number of errors of cognition associated with the identification, and subsequent use, of relevant patient data. Task-specific user interfaces, developed from an understanding of provider information requirements, offer advantages over interfaces currently available within a standard electronic medical record.

Randomized Controlled Trial Multicenter StudyDexamethasone in children mechanically ventilated for lower respiratory tract infection caused by respiratory syncytial virus: a randomized controlled trial.
To determine the efficacy of dexamethasone in the treatment of mechanically ventilated children with respiratory syncytial virus-severe lower respiratory tract infection. ⋯ In this prematurely ended trial in children mechanically ventilated for severe respiratory syncytial virus-lower respiratory tract infection, we found no evidence of a beneficial effect of dexamethasone in children with mild oxygenation abnormalities. Neither was evidence found that dexamethasone may prolong mechanical ventilation in those with severe oxygenation abnormalities.

Randomized Controlled Trial Multicenter StudyA phase II randomized placebo-controlled trial of omega-3 fatty acids for the treatment of acute lung injury.
Administration of eicosapentaenoic acid and docosahexanoic acid, omega-3 fatty acids in fish oil, has been associated with improved patient outcomes in acute lung injury when studied in a commercial enteral formula. However, fish oil has not been tested independently in acute lung injury. We therefore sought to determine whether enteral fish oil alone would reduce pulmonary and systemic inflammation in patients with acute lung injury. ⋯ Fish oil did not reduce biomarkers of pulmonary or systemic inflammation in patients with acute lung injury, and the results do not support the conduct of a larger clinical trial in this population with this agent. This experimental approach is feasible for proof-of-concept studies evaluating new treatments for acute lung injury.

Randomized Controlled TrialA randomized trial of the effect of patient race on physicians' intensive care unit and life-sustaining treatment decisions for an acutely unstable elder with end-stage cancer.
To test whether hospital-based physicians made different intensive care unit and life-sustaining treatment decisions for otherwise identical black and white patients with end-stage cancer and life-threatening hypoxia. ⋯ In this exploratory study, hospital-based physicians did not make different treatment decisions for otherwise identical terminally ill black and white elders despite believing that black patients are more likely to prefer intensive life-sustaining treatment, and they grossly overestimated the preference for intensive treatment for both races.
